What Does The Word Umbrella Come From . History tells us (via encyclopedia britannica) that umbrellas existed in many ancient societies, including those of egypt, mesopotamia, china, and india, where they served to protect important people from the sun, thereby serving also as a sign of prestige and power. The earliest known use of the noun umbrella is in the early 1600s. The word umbrella is from the latin word umbra, which in turn derives from the ancient greek ombros, meaning “shade” or “shadow”. The word umbrella comes from the latin root word umbra, meaning shade or shadow. The word umbrella was first used in europe around the 16th century to describe small, foldable umbrellas used as sunshades. 1600, in donne's letters, from italian ombrello , from late latin. Starting in the 16th century the umbrella became popular in the western world, especially in the rainy climates of northern europe.
